This replacement part is an upper rack slide, and it is intended for use in different types of appliances. This is a genuine replacement part made by General Electric. This upper rack slide is an important part of many appliances. This particular one is typically found in dishwashers and helps guide the upper rack in and out. This allows the user to have easy access to the rack in order to place and remove dishes before and after the cleaning process. A new upper slide rack might be needed if the current ones are broken or damaged in any way. It is possible that these slides become stripped over many years of use and need to be replaced. If the upper rack is tilted or not sturdy while being slid back inside the main tub, the upper rack slide might be the problem. Be sure the dishwasher is completely empty prior to replacing this part. This is a genuine OEM part and is sourced directly from the manufacturer. This upper arm rack slide is sold individually.

The Sump Inlet is an OEM part for GE dishwashers. This part allows water to flow into the sump area, which collects and drains used wash water from the tub during the dishwashing cycle.
Causes of a bad part can range from clogs or obstructions preventing proper water flow, physical damage or cracks leading to leaks, or general wear and tear over time.

This fine filter assembly sits in the bottom of the dishwasher tub and screens out small food particles so recirculating water stays cleaner. Replacing a torn or warped filter helps restore wash performance and protects the pump and spray arms from debris.
Filter replacement is easy. CAUTION. When removing the wand that is immediately above this filter you must reach around the back base and feel for a tab sticking out. Pull on it and lift the wand up. If not you may break the tab off which is a retainer needed for the center wand that supplies water to the upper rack. This arm valve installs in the dishwasher's spray arm feed to control water flow. It helps maintain proper pressure so the spray arm spins and distributes water evenly for effective cleaning.

This vent pad cushions and seals the dishwasher's door vent, helping route steam out of the tub while protecting the inner door and control area from moisture. Replacing a worn pad can help stop vent leaks and rattling.

The Dishwasher Upper Rack Kit 4 Pack is an OEM part for GE dishwashers. This kit includes four sets of studs and rollers that attach to the upper rack, allowing it to slide smoothly in and out of the dishwasher.
Causes of bad studs and rollers can include regular wear and tear, exposure to high temperatures and water, or damage from heavy or improperly loaded items.

This is a hose chamber, or dishwasher hose pump. This part attaches to the back of the dishwasher and is the direct line for the water to get in and out during the washing cycle. This specific part prevents leaking and is very important to the machine. The user might need to replace this part if the dishwasher is leaking, if the machine is not putting in or draining water properly, or if the machine has stopped working altogether. Anyone can complete this repair with basic household tools such as a screwdriver, pliers, and working gloves. Always make sure the machine is empty of dishes and is drained of water before starting the repair. Also make sure it is unplugged from the electrical source and is turned off completely. This is an OEM part sourced directly from the manufacturer. It is sold individually. This part is compatible with machines from manufacturers like General Electric, Hotpoint, RCA, and more.

This leveling screw adjusts your dishwasher's leveling leg so you can set the cabinet height and get the unit perfectly level. Proper leveling helps the door seal correctly, reduces rocking, and cuts excess vibration and noise.

This hose clamp kit secures the washer's hoses at the pump, tub, or valve connections, helping stop leaks and hose blow-offs. Replace worn or missing clamps to restore a tight, reliable seal during fill, wash, and drain.

This lever connects to the dishwasher detergent dispenser mechanism and actuates the cup lid. A worn or damaged lever can prevent the dispenser from opening at the right time, reducing wash performance.
